#c84d6d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c84d6d is composed of 78.4% red, 30.2% green and 42.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 61.5% magenta, 45.5%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 344.4 degrees, a saturation of 52.8% and a lightness of 54.3%. #c84d6d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9ada with #910000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

Shades and Tints of #c84d6d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020101 is the darkest color, while #fbf2f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c84d6d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#928387 is the less saturated color, while #fe1753 is the most saturated one.
